Respondents PRAYER: Criminal Original petition is filed under Section 482 of Criminal Procedure Code, praying to direct the second respondent to register a case on the basis of the petitioner's complaint dated 26.01.2018 and investigate the same in accordance with law. For Petitioner : Mr.R.Karunanidhi For Respondents : Mr.Prabu Ramachandran Government Advocate (Crl.Side)

O R D E R

This petition has been filed to direct the second respondent to register a case based on the complaint given by the petitioner dated 26.01.2018.

2. Heard the learned counsel appearing for the petitioner and the Government Advocate (Crl.Side) appearing on behalf of the respondents.

3. The learned counsel for the petitioner has submitted that the petitioner has borrowed a sum of Rs.25,000/- from the proposed accused and at that time, the proposed accused informed the petitioner that he should pay sum of Rs.1,500/- as interest for the aforesaid amount. Further a mortgage deed was executed on 25.10.2010. Subsequently, the petitioner has discharged the said mortgage and requested the proposed accused to return the documents. But he refused to return the same. Hence the petitioner has lodged a complaint on 26.01.2018. But so far no action has been taken.

4. The learned Government Advocate (Crl.Side) has submitted that after receipt of the said complaint CSR No.136 of 2018 has been issued and the complaint is pending for enquiry. https://hcservices.ecourts.gov.in/hcservices/

5. Considering the aforesaid submissions, the second respondent

is directed to enquire into the matter. If it reveals any cognizable offence, then he has to register a case and proceed in accordance with law. If the enquiry reveals only a civil dispute, he has to direct the parties to approach the concerned court and get appropriate relief.

6. Recording the aforesaid submissions, this criminal original petition is disposed of.
